# Shoreline Tides widget — env file
# This file configures the Brinewatch tide-table widget served to the
# Port Maravel marina kiosks. Refresh interval and station list live in
# the admin panel, not here. Support should only edit this file when
# rotating credentials for the upstream tide feed. The feed access
# secret is set on the line below.

vault entry, kafog-yahop: COURIER_KEY8=0faa53ae

## Shared Lab Access — Floor 3

Heads up: the Fernwick Lab is shared with the Optics team from Bramleigh Dynamics, so expect their folks badging in too. Their passes only work weekdays. If someone from either team gets stuck at the door, the facilities desk can let them in with the fallback code below.

turnstile pass: bdg-N-15

Ticket: Staging env misconfigured for Siftgate bloom filter

The bloom layer in front of the Pellet KV store is rejecting all lookups in staging because the env file was copied from the dev template without credentials. False-positive tuning values are fine; only the auth line is missing. To unblock the weekly demo, the Pellet admission secret must be set on the following line.

env line for yaguf-fajop: LEDGER_TOKEN13=fb08984397349